LASAG provides practical and emotional support to anyone affected by mesothelioma and other asbestos-related diseases across London and The South East. Our team understand the impact such diseases have on individuals and their families, both physically and psychologically, and are very experienced in delivering support at home, over the phone and at our monthly support groups. They are knowledgeable about benefits and compensation schemes, and maintain close liaison with other key professionals in the care of the sufferer and their families.
